My ipod nano 3rd gen. is not recognized by my computer or itunes. Support page does not help.

My macbook is not recognizing my 3rd gen. ipod nano after I reset the ipod. THe finder not itunes recognizes it. Can someone help?

If you have not already, disconnect the iPod and restart your Mac. Do this to Reset the iPod.


http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1320


Once the Mac restarts, run iTunes and connect the iPod.


If that does not help, try putting the iPod into Disk Mode


http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1363


then, connect it to the Mac running iTunes. It's possible that iTunes will tell you that you need to Restore the iPod.
